According to Stratistics MRC, the Global Hair Growth Serum Market is accounted for $2.9 billion in 2026 and is expected to reach $6.1 billion by 2034 growing at a CAGR of 9.5% during the forecast period. Hair growth serums are topical formulations designed to stimulate follicles, reduce shedding, and promote thicker, healthier hair through active ingredients like minoxidil, biotin, and natural botanicals. These products address growing consumer concerns about thinning hair, pattern baldness, and stress-related hair loss across demographics. The market spans various formulations targeting specific hair types and gender-specific needs, distributed through pharmacies, e-commerce platforms, and specialty retail channels worldwide.

Market Dynamics:

Driver:

Increasing prevalence of stress-related hair disorders

Rising stress levels across global populations are directly contributing to higher incidence of telogen effluvium and other stress-induced hair conditions. Modern lifestyles characterized by work pressure, digital overload, and economic uncertainties trigger hormonal imbalances that disrupt natural hair growth cycles. Consumers increasingly seek targeted solutions beyond general wellness, creating sustained demand for clinically effective hair growth serums. This trend spans all demographics, from young professionals experiencing early thinning to middle-aged populations facing age-related hair concerns, expanding the addressable market beyond traditional baldness treatments to broader hair health maintenance.

Restraint:

High product costs and lengthy treatment timelines

Premium pricing of clinically proven hair growth serums limits accessibility for price-sensitive consumers despite widespread interest in solutions. Effective formulations require consistent application over several months before visible results appear, testing consumer patience and commitment. This extended timeline creates high dropout rates as users abandon treatments before experiencing benefits, reducing long-term market penetration. Insurance coverage rarely extends to cosmetic hair concerns, placing full financial burden on consumers. Economic pressures during inflationary periods further discourage investment in products requiring sustained financial commitment without guaranteed outcomes, slowing overall market expansion.

Opportunity:

Integration of clean beauty and natural ingredients

Growing consumer preference for clean, sustainable formulations creates significant opportunities for innovation in hair growth serums. Plant-based alternatives featuring rosemary oil, saw palmetto, and caffeine appeal to consumers seeking efficacy without synthetic chemicals or potential side effects. Brands formulating with organic, ethically sourced ingredients capture premium positioning while addressing concerns about long-term ingredient safety. Transparency in sourcing and manufacturing resonates with conscious consumers who scrutinize product labels. This clean beauty alignment extends market reach beyond traditional pharmaceutical approaches, attracting wellness-focused demographics previously hesitant about conventional hair loss treatments.

Threat:

Intensifying competition from alternative hair restoration solutions

Diverse treatment options including low-level laser therapy, platelet-rich plasma injections, hair transplantation, and oral supplements create competitive pressure on topical serums. These alternatives often promise faster results or permanent solutions, drawing consumers away from daily application regimens. Professional treatments gain credibility through clinical settings and specialist endorsements, while oral supplements offer convenience advantages. Technological advancements continuously introduce new competitors, from stem cell therapies to microneedling devices. This crowded treatment landscape fragments consumer attention and spending, limiting individual product category growth despite expanding overall interest in hair restoration.

Covid-19 Impact:

The COVID-19 pandemic significantly impacted hair growth serum markets through multiple mechanisms. Post-illness hair shedding, widely reported among recovered patients, created urgent demand for restorative treatments. Lockdown-related stress and lifestyle disruptions triggered widespread temporary hair loss, introducing new consumers to hair growth products. Remote work arrangements normalized video conferencing, increasing self-awareness about appearance and driving proactive hair health investments. E-commerce acceleration during pandemic restrictions benefited direct-to-consumer hair serum brands while traditional retail channels faced disruption, permanently shifting distribution patterns toward digital-first purchasing behaviors.

The Straight Hair segment is expected to be the largest during the forecast period

The Straight Hair segment is expected to account for the largest market share during the forecast period, driven by its global demographic prevalence across Asian, Caucasian, and other populations. Straight hair textures allow serum ingredients to penetrate the scalp more directly without curl patterns creating application barriers. Formulation stability is simpler for straight hair targeted products, enabling broader manufacturer participation. Mass market appeal across diverse geographic regions ensures consistent demand. The segment benefits from extensive consumer education resources and established product formats that have built trust and familiarity among straight-haired consumers seeking hair growth solutions.

The Gender-Neutral Products segment is expected to have the highest CAGR during the forecast period

Over the forecast period, the Gender-Neutral Products segment is predicted to witness the highest growth rate, reflecting broader societal shifts toward inclusive marketing and product development. Younger consumers increasingly reject gender-based product segmentation, seeking formulations based on hair concerns rather than identity. Brands responding with gender-neutral packaging and ingredient profiles capture this values-aligned demographic while simplifying inventory management. Marketing approaches emphasizing efficacy over gender expand addressable audiences across all consumers. Social media influence amplifies gender-neutral messaging, accelerating adoption. This segment growth represents fundamental restructuring of traditional beauty categorization toward personalized, inclusive approaches.

Region with largest share:

During the forecast period, the North America region is expected to hold the largest market share, supported by high consumer awareness about hair health, established dermatology infrastructure, and significant disposable income for premium personal care. The region's direct-to-consumer brand ecosystem continuously innovates with subscription models and digital-first marketing that drives engagement. Extensive direct-to-consumer advertising allowances enable aggressive consumer education campaigns. Medical professional endorsement of clinically proven serums builds credibility. Strong e-commerce penetration facilitates easy access to specialized products. Celebrity culture and social media influence amplify hair concerns and treatment awareness across all demographics.

Region with highest CAGR:

Over the forecast period, the Asia Pacific region is anticipated to exhibit the highest CAGR, driven by massive populations with high hair care prioritization and increasing disposable incomes across emerging economies. Traditional herbal hair care practices create natural receptivity to botanical serum formulations. Rapid urbanization and associated lifestyle stresses increase hair concerns among working populations. K-beauty and J-beauty influences export sophisticated hair care innovations throughout the region. Expanding e-commerce infrastructure connects consumers with international brands previously unavailable. Rising middle-class aspirations include investment in personal appearance, with hair health representing a visible indicator of overall wellness and self-care commitment.

Key Developments:

In January 2026, The Ordinary teased the upcoming release of the Volufiline + Pal-Isoleucine 1% formula, while continuing to scale its "Multi-Peptide Serum for Hair Density," which remains one of the top-selling non-prescription hair serums globally.

In December 2025, Unilever emphasized its "skinification of scalp care" strategy, utilizing advanced ingredients like niacinamide (vitamin B3) and ceramides in its Dove and Clear serum lines to fortify the scalp barrier and reduce hair fall by up to 95%.
